Re: [EVDL] Chevy Bolt Level3 fast charging time

2021-02-23 Thread Peter VanDerWal via EV
Not sure where you you read that, but I'm betting it said 55kw and not 55kwh. The bolt can charge at up to 55kw (assuming you are plugged into at least an 80kw DC fast charger) but it will only charge at that rate until the battery gets to 55% SOC, then it drops down to 35kw until it hits 70%
